Course Description

Overview

This course focuses on ‘Positive Psychology’ (PP) which is a relatively new branch of psychology that aims to understand, test, discover and promote the factors that allow individuals and communities to thrive. PP is based upon 3 primary concerns: Positive emotions, Positive individual traits, and Positive institutions. This course will introduce the learners to these fundamental aspects of PP, apart from highlighting some of the core PP concepts including – Happiness, Flow, Mindfulness, Optimism, Resilience, Emotional Intelligence, Spirituality and Self-Related concepts (Self-efficacy, Self-esteem, Ideal-self and Real-self, Self-regulation) etc. This course will facilitate understanding positive aspects of human behavior.
